  6. Medical cannabis -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Medical_cannabis

    A study found that CBD significantly reduced anxiety during a simulated public speaking test for individuals with social anxiety disorder. However, the relationship between cannabis use and anxiety symptoms is complex, and while some users report relief, the overall evidence from observational studies and clinical trials remains inconclusive.
